辊涂型卷烟接嘴胶动态流变性能对其上机适用性的影响 被引量:5

Influences of dynamic rheological properties of tipping glue on its adaptability
下载PDF
导出
摘要 为了解决烟用水基胶上机运行时常出现烟支质量及运行质量不佳的问题,采用非牛顿流体的Ostwald-de Wale幂律方程模型,对HAUNI Protos 2-2适用辊涂型接嘴胶的动态流变检测数据进行拟合,计算出非牛顿指数n值,考察不同接嘴胶的动态流变性能。研究了辊涂型接嘴胶动态流变性能对烟支卷接质量、生产运行质量的影响。试验结果表明:(1)辊涂型接嘴胶的动态流变性能对涂胶量以及渗透行为产生影响,非牛顿指数n值过大及过小均影响接嘴胶的实际上机使用效果。(2)非牛顿指数n值越大,涂胶量越大,干燥速度越慢,易出现接装纸皱纹;反之,干燥速度越快,易出现空隙性接装纸泡皱及掉头。(3)非牛顿指数n值越大,接嘴胶实际黏度越高,切刀、吸纸轮、搓接鼓轮、搓板等部位粘附的胶垢越多,被动停机保养次数增加,生产效率受到影响。对于本实验中所用的Protos 2-2型超高速卷烟机设备状态和所用的接装纸而言,其适配的接嘴胶非牛顿指数在0.825~0.866区间时可获得较为理想的上机适用性。 In order to promote cigarette quality and machine efficiency, the dynamic rheological data of tipping glue adaptable to HAUNI Protos 2-2 were fitted with Ostwald-de Wale power-law formula, and non-Newton index n of the same was calculated to investigate the dynamic rheological properties of different tipping glues. The influences of dynamic rheological properties of tipping glue on the quality of filter assembling and machine running status were studied, and the results showed that: 1) The dynamic theological properties affected the application amount and permeation behavior of glue, too large or too small n had a negative influence on its operational adaptability. 2) Bigger n associated with more glue application and led to slow drying, wrinkled tipping might occur. On the contrary bubble-like wrinkle tipping or filter missing might occur due to rapid drying. 3) When bigger n and higher viscosity glue was used, glue would build up on cutter, paper-cutting drum, rolling drum and rolling plate more rapidly, which increased the frequencies of machine shutdown. For the status of Protos 2-2 cigarette maker and the tipping paper used in this experiment, the appropriate range for non-Newton index n of tipping glue was from 0.825 to 0.866.
